Sperm only lasts a few minutes in open air. After showering, and washing your hands the sperm was not only dead, but down the drain. There is no possibility of pregnancy in this case.
Ejaculation into the vagina must occur in order for sperm to pass the cervix. There are millions of sperm in one ejaculation, however females only produce one egg. If the egg is not fertilized without a few days of ovulation you will not become pregnant.
With that being said, I hope you understand that since you did not have intercourse you cannot become pregnant.
